Welcome to the Summer Nights Track Circuit!!


The Summer Nights Track Meets are an all-comers meet at the Farmington High Track, where people of all ages are welcome to come and participate! Want to prove you still got it in the short sprints? We have a race for you. Want to beat your parents in a mile? This is the right place. Want to get your kids out and experiencing track and field? Your in the right place, try the family relay! Can you run a mile at the same pace every time without even thinking? Try the jogger's mile!

Events that are contested, the format, schedule, and information can be found below. We are excited for you to come race with us!

Cost:

$5 per person (up to 4 events!) or $20 per family.

What to Expect:

On race day come to the Farmington High School track (548 Glovers Lane - the track entrance is on the east side of the school) and then head to the check-in table to pay, and then collect the stickers for each event that you will be competing in that night. These stickers will be collected before lane races, and after distance races to help us to accurately assign finish times. We will make announcements before each race for when we are ready for you to be at the start line so we can organize the heats. This is going to be very low stress, and lots of fun!
